Quick reference
PaO₂ oxygenation: 80–100 normal · 60–79 mild hypoxemia · 40–59 moderate hypoxemia · <40 severe hypoxemia · >100 hyperoxemia.
P/F ratio: PaO₂ divided by FiO₂ as a decimal. Normal is usually >300. ARDS categories are mild 201–300, moderate 101–200, and severe ≤100.
ARDS criteria: acute timing, bilateral opacities, impaired oxygenation, and respiratory failure not fully explained by cardiac failure or fluid overload.
